Establishing a US Company: A Step-by-Step Guide
Wiki Article
Starting a business in the United States may appear complex but is achievable with careful planning and execution. This step-by-step guide will walk you through the essential steps involved in registering your own US company. The process may differ slightly depending on your chosen legal structure, state of operation, and specific industry regulations.
- First, decide the legal structure that best suits your business needs. Common choices include sole proprietorships, partnerships, limited liability companies (LLCs), and corporations. Each structure has its own benefits and disadvantages regarding liability, taxation, and administrative requirements.
- Then, choose a unique and memorable business name that complies with state naming conventions. You'll need to confirm the name's availability with your state's secretary of state.
- Upon choosing your legal structure and name, you'll need to file the necessary paperwork with your state. This typically involves completing articles of incorporation or organization, depending on your chosen structure, and submitting them along with the required filing charges.
- Acquire an Employer Identification Number (EIN) from the IRS. This nine-digit number is used for tax purposes and could be required by banks and other financial institutions.
- In conclusion, ensure you comply all applicable state and federal regulations for your industry. This may include obtaining licenses, permits, or certifications specific to your business activities.

Procedures for US Corporation Registration Simplified
Navigating the realm of business establishment can be a daunting task. Nevertheless, registering your corporation in the US doesn't have to be complicated. This guide will walk you through the fundamentals to make the process seamless.
First, you'll need to choose a uncommon name for your corporation and verify its availability. Next, you'll register the necessary paperwork with your state's secretary of government. Be sure to attach all required documents, such as articles of formation.
Upon your corporation is officially registered, you'll need to acquire an Employer Identification Number (EIN) from the IRS. This number will be vital for financial purposes. Finally, establish a business bank account and start operating your corporation.
